PITTSBURGH, PA – Allegheny County Sheriff Kevin M. Kraus announced yesterday the arrest of 33-year-old Laron Robinson, a Wilkinsburg man with a history of violence against women. Robinson was wanted for a probation violation involving a 2022 case in which he pleaded guilty to strangulation and terroristic threats.

In addition, he faces an active warrant from City of Pittsburgh Police accusing him of aggravated assault, simple assault, and terroristic threats in connection with a September 2022 incident where his ex-girlfriend reported being assaulted with a knife.

Detectives from the sheriff’s office received information that Robinson was at a location in New Kensington.

They collaborated with New Kensington Police and arrested Robinson without incident at a residence on Freeport Road. Robinson was then transported to the Allegheny County Jail where he awaits further possible charges.
